Maximo Alcocer - 2012

HIGH SCHOOL - Four-time All-Region selection while at Windsor Forest High School in Savannah...Reached the Region Final in 2012 as the team posted a 13-2-0 overall record...Captained the Tigers as a junior and senior, earning 2011 All-Greater Savannah honors.

PERSONAL - Born Maximo Adrian Alcocer on May 17, 1993 in Providence, R.I...Son of Maximo I. and Samara M. Alcocer...Has a brother Paolo...Grandfather Maximo Alcocer played for Bolivia National Team in 1958 and 1962 World Cup Qualifying Stages...Tallied four goals in Bolivia's unsuccessful qualification bids, which included a 2-0 win over Argentina in 1957...Grandfather scored five goals in 1963 South American Championship, earning the Silver Boot as Bolivia won the nation's only major tournament championship...Father Maximo I. Alcocer played in the Bolivian second division...Favorite meal is Chinese food...Favorite athlete is Wayne Rooney...His father has had the biggest influence on his life because he coached him from a young age.
